Taiwan seen in market for transport helicopters.

HELOS FOR TAIWAN: The Taiwanese army plans to buy a new fleet of transport helicopters worth about $1.1 billion, according to reports from Taipei. The army is looking for 12 heavy and 100 medium-sized helicopters to replace its Bell UH-1Hs.
